Can you legally convert a semi auto to full auto?

Under federal law, fully automatic weapons are technically legal only if made before 1986, when Congress passed the Firearm Owners’ Protection Act. The second major loophole is that it’s legal to sell and buy modification kits that can convert semiautomatic weapons into effectively automatic ones.

What is drilling the 3rd hole?

As as far as the ATF cares, simply having the third hole means having a machine gun. You can’t build a modern machine gun without having an FFL, and it can’t be transferred to an individual from the FFL anyway.

What caliber is an AR-15 assault rifle?

223/5.56mm NATO
The AR-15 is nominally chambered in . 223/5.56mm NATO, but many variants have been produced in different calibers such as . 22-LR, 7.62×39mm, 9×19mm Parabellum and shotgun calibers.

What is auto sear?

An “auto sear” is a part designed and intended for use in converting a semi-automatic weapon to shoot automatically by a single pull of the trigger and is a machine gun under federal law.

Is an AR15 fully automatic?

An assault rifle is a fully automatic rifle. The AR-15 commonly available is not an assault rifle. It’s a modern sporting rifle. It is semi-automatic, it looks like an assault rifle, but is different in its operation and capabilities.

What is a full auto AR 15?

There are no fully automatic AR-15s. An AR-15 is a semi-automatic rifle. The M16 is select-fire, as is the M4. M4s are not legal for civilian purchase since they started being manufactured after 1986.
